How Big Is Tanzania?

Tanzania, located in Africa, is the 31st largest country in the world, covering approximately 947,300 square kilometers (365,754 square miles). That's about 1.4 times the size of Texas. It is home to approximately 63.9 million people.

Tanzania's Geography

Of its total area, 885,800 km² is land and 61,500 km² (6.5%) is water. Tanzania has approximately 1,424 km of coastline. Within Africa, Tanzania is the 13th largest of 55 countries, sitting between Egypt and Nigeria. With 67 people per km², it is less densely populated than the African average of 103 per km².

How Far Across Is Tanzania?

Tanzania stretches approximately 1,198 km (744 mi) from north to south — roughly the distance from London to Rome, and 1,226 km (762 mi) from east to west — roughly the distance from Denver to Chicago. At highway speeds, it would take roughly 14 hours to drive across.
